THE "DDD" BURGER



The

Provided by Food Network

Categories     main-dish

Time 25m

Yield 4 burgers

Number Of Ingredients 9

Oil, for frying
2 cups cold water
2 bags batter mix (recommended: Joes Famous Batter Mix)
1 1/3 pounds 85/15 ground chuck
4 (4-inch) hamburger buns
8 slices American cheese
1/2 cup chopped white onions
4 slices tomato
16 slices hamburger pickles

Steps:

  • Preheat deep-fryer to 350 degrees F.
  • Place frying pan or flat top grill over medium-high setting.
  • Grab a medium size mixing bowl, and a whisk. Add 2 cups of cold water in mixing bowl and empty the contents of the batter mix in with water and mix together until batter is of pancake batter consistency.
  • Take the ground chuck and shape it into 4 (1/3-pound) patties. Then grill on flat top or pan fry to your desired internal temperature. When burger is cooked remove the patties from pan or grill and set aside.
  • Take hamburger buns and open them up and set them on the counter so that the insides are facing up. Place 1 piece of cheese on top of each side of all hamburger buns facing up. Spinkle diced onions on all bottom pieces. Then place 1 slice of tomato on the cheese on the top buns. Then put 4 slices of hamburger pickles on top of each tomato slice. Gently put the cooked hamburger patty on top of either of the buns and smash both the top and bottom buns together. The tighter the better!
  • Take the hamburger and insert into the mixing bowl with batter and surround burger with batter.
  • Place evenly coated burger bun with ingredients and burger patty into fryer. Remove burgers when outside coating of batter is a golden brown color. Serve with desired side item.

MY HUSBAND'S FAVORITE BAKED BURGERS



My Husband's Favorite Baked Burgers image

Simple, flavorful hamburger recipe that my husband loves. Ketchup is the binder so no egg is required. They hold together very well. I bake them in the oven and they come out perfect every time! I serve these with a slice of cheese melted on top. Top as desired.

Provided by MINNIE000

Categories     Main Dish Recipes     Burger Recipes     Hamburgers

Time 40m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 pound lean ground beef
½ cup seasoned bread crumbs
¼ cup ketchup
4 tablespoons Worcestershire sauce
1 tablespoon garlic powder
1 tablespoon onion powder
½ teaspoon mustard powder
salt and ground black pepper to taste

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C).
  • Combine ground beef, bread crumbs, ketchup, Worcestershire sauce, garlic powder, onion powder, mustard powder, salt, and black pepper in a bowl until well mixed. Form into 4 patties and place on a baking sheet.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until no longer pink in the center, about 30 minutes. An instant-read thermometer inserted into the center should read at least 160 degrees F (70 degrees C). Serve immediately.

COUNTRY FRIED HAMBURGER STEAKS WITH GRAVY



Country Fried Hamburger Steaks With Gravy image

If you can "Country Fry" chicken, pork , and beef cube steaks, why not ground beef patties ? Well, with this recipe you can.:) When handling the "steaks" please take care when turning over in the egg/milk mixture,because they might crumble.And the same goes for turning over in the seasoned flour.For easier handling of the "steaks" you may want to freeze them for about 1/2 an hour or until they are slightly firm.If desired please adjust seasonings according to your tastes.For a true comfort meal serve with your favorite mashed potato and green bean recipes.Submitted to "ZARR" on November 21st,2008

Provided by Chef shapeweaver

Categories     Meat

Time 35m

Yield 3 steaks, 3 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 large egg
1/2 cup milk
3/4 cup self-rising flour, use leftover seasoned flour for the gravy
1 teaspoon seasoning salt
1/2 teaspoon ground black pepper
1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
1 lb lean ground beef
oil (for frying)
3 tablespoons seasoned flour
3 tablespoons oil
1 cup milk

Steps:

  • In a shallow dish beat together egg and 1/2 cup milk, set aside.
  • In another shallow dish or on a plate mix together 3/4 cup of flour,seasoned salt,pepper,and garlic powder.
  • Shape ground beef into three equal sized oval "steaks" and flatten into 1/4 inch thickness.
  • Add each "steak" one at a time to egg mixture, coating both sides well.
  • Then add each "steak" to seasoned flour,making sure to cover each side well.
  • Heat oil over medium heat in skillet large enough to hold all the "steaks".
  • Add "steaks" to hot but not smoking oil, cook until both sides are golden brown.
  • Remove "steaks" and keep warm.
  • To make gravy, drain all but 3 Tablespoons oil, add flour and stir into oil until a paste like texture is reached.
  • Cook this mixture (roux) for about 5 minutes on medium heat to eliminate the raw flower taste, then warm the milk before adding to roux.
  • Stir in milk a little at a time until desired thickness is reached, if you want it a little thinner add a bit of water.
  • At this point,taste and add more seasoning if desired.
  • Pour gravy over "steaks" and mashed potatoes.

BREADED HAMBURGERS



Breaded Hamburgers image

This recipe is from my great grandmother and is super easy. It is made using bread crumbs, eggs, and hamburger patties. Best served with fried potatoes.

Provided by BAYBERS

Categories     Main Dish Recipes     Burger Recipes     100+ Hamburger Recipes

Time 40m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 pound ground beef
¼ teaspoon salt, or to taste
½ teaspoon ground black pepper, or to taste
½ teaspoon garlic powder, or to taste
2 teaspoons Worcestershire sauce
2 eggs
1 ½ cups bread crumbs
¼ cup vegetable oil for frying
1 small onion, sliced into rings

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
  • Whisk eggs together in a small bowl. Place bread crumbs on a plate. In a medium bowl, mix together the ground beef, salt, pepper, garlic powder, and Worcestershire sauce. Form into 4 patties. Dip burger patties into egg, then press into bread crumbs to coat.
  • Heat o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Brown the breaded hamburgers on each side, about 2 minutes per side.
  • Place onion rings in the bottom of a baking dish or casserole dish. Pour in just enough water to cover the bottom, but not cover the onion. Carefully place burgers on top of the onions in the baking dish without touching the water.
  • Bake for 25 to 30 minutes in the preheated oven, until burgers are well done.

CHEESY, STUFFED PORTOBELLO MUSHROOM BURGERS



Cheesy, Stuffed Portobello Mushroom Burgers image

Mushrooms are wonderful and, these days, they are getting called upon to play so many different parts. One of the most popular things is to use mushrooms as a substitute for meat. It works well because they have such wonderful texture and heartiness. The portobello is the top dog of the cultivated mushroom world because it's large and can be a meal unto itself. They are cultivated mushrooms (as opposed to wild, foraged kinds) and are earthy and meaty. Regarding mushrooms in general: Wash them just before cooking (if they are dirty) so they are clean but don't sit around, waterlogged, in your fridge. Many people scrape the brown "ribs" out of the insides of the portobello and peel the outer skin. Why? I say leave everything on the mushroom (except dirt). Make sure you cook mushrooms long enough-they take longer than you think to reach full flavor.

Provided by Alex Guarnaschelli

Categories     main-dish

Time 1h

Yield 2 burgers

Number Of Ingredients 14

4 large portobello mushrooms, wiped of any dirt
1 medium yellow onion, thinly sliced
6 large garlic cloves
1/2 cup extra-virgin olive oil, divided use
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
2 large eggs, lightly beaten
2 cups panko breadcrumbs
2 teaspoons granulated garlic
3/4 cup shredded Monterey Jack cheese
8 basil leaves, torn
2 to 4 iceberg lettuce leaves
Sliced dill pickles and pickle juice, for serving
Red wine vinegar, to drizzle
2 burger buns, buttered and toasted

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 425 degrees F. Line 2 rimmed baking sheets with parchment and set aside.
  • Roast the mushrooms: Arrange the mushrooms, stem side up, onions and garlic cloves in a single layer on 1 prepared baking sheet. Drizzle with half of the olive oil. Drizzle 1/2 cup water around the mushrooms on the baking sheet. Season generously with salt and pepper. Roast in the center of the oven until the mushrooms shrink in size and become darker brown, 15 to 18 minutes. Remove and let cool.
  • Bread the mushrooms: In a medium bowl, whisk the eggs with a splash of water. In another medium bowl, combine the breadcrumbs with the granulated garlic. Dip each mushroom in the egg mixture and then coat completely with the breadcrumbs. Reserve everything.
  • Fry the mushrooms: In a large skillet, heat the remaining olive oil over medium heat until it begins to smoke. Add the mushrooms in a single layer. Cook on one side until golden brown, 2 to 3 minutes. Flip and cook on the second side until golden brown, another 2 to 3 minutes. Remove the mushrooms from the oil and arrange in a single layer on a clean baking sheet. Season with salt and pepper.
  • Make the filling: In a medium bowl, combine the roasted garlic cloves and onion slices with the cheese. Add any remaining egg and 1/4 cup of the breadcrumbs leftover from the breading. Add the basil and mix well.
  • Assemble and bake: On the same baking sheet, place 2 portobellos, stem-side up, with some distance between them. Pile half of the filling on each and then top with the remaining mushrooms, pressing gently but firmly down, so it forms a fairly compact sandwich. Bake until the cheese melts, 6 to 8 minutes.
  • Arrange the lettuce to form 2 cups. Drizzle some pickle juice and red wine vinegar into the cups. Season with salt and pepper and then top with some sliced pickles.
  • Place each mushroom burger onto a bottom bun. Flip a lettuce cup onto each burger and top with the top bun. Serve.

DELICIOUS BREADED CHICKEN BURGERS



Delicious Breaded Chicken Burgers image

I was on a quest to make chicken burgers using ground chicken. I found this recipe, and made a few minor revisions. I think they turned out perfect and the family loved them. Source: "How to Make Delicious Breaded Chicken Burgers" http://www.theartofdoingstuff.com/how-to-make-delicious-breaded-chicken-burgers/ I made 5 large chicken burgers and they did not shrink upon cooking.

Provided by Chicagoland Chef du

Categories     Chicken

Time 30m

Yield 4-5 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 15

1 lb ground chicken, white meat
1 egg, slightly beaten
1/2 cup dry breadcrumbs, pre seasoned
1 teaspoon milk
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on pepper
1/4 teaspoon onion powder
1/4 teaspoon garlic powder
breading
1/2 cup flour
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/8 pepper
1 large egg, beaten, add a splash of water to thin if desired
1 cup dry breadcrumbs, pre seasoned, may use less
2 -3 tablespoons canola oil

Steps:

  • In a bowl: Add ground chicken, egg, salt, pepper, onion powder, garlic powder together. Add in bread crumbs, milk, gently combine with hands. Set aside.
  • In 3 shallow bowls: Bowl 1: beaten egg with water. Bowl 2: seasoned flour with salt & pepper, Bowl 3: seasoned bread crumbs.
  • Using 1/3 cup measuring cup as a measuring tool, scoop out your burger portions.
  • HINT: I found it was less messy to drop the scoop of meat into the flour, turn it over, lift it out of the flour, then form into patty.
  • Coat both sides of chicken patty with flour, dip in egg wash, then pat into the breadcrumbs to coat.
  • At this point I placed patties on a platter, covered with plastic wrap and put them in the fridge for 1-2 hours. This step is not necessary but can be done ahead of time. It will allow the flavors to develop.
  • Panfry in (4 Tablespoons) cooking oil for about 4 minutes on each side. *add a little oil at a time, add more when you flip the chicken if necessary. Add more cooking time if your burgers are plump. Do not over cook or they will dry out.
  • Serving suggestions: on soft buns with sliced dill pickles, mayonaise, honey mustard or spicy , tomato slices and lettuce or whatever you like.

BAKED HAMBURGERS



Baked Hamburgers image

This baked hamburgers recipe is hearty and moist. The onion gives it a special flavor, and the sweet-flavored sauce further enhances the taste. I serve these as an entree with accompanying vegetables or on a bun as a sandwich. -Marg Bisgrove, Widewater, Alberta

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Lunch

Time 45m

Yield 2 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 13

1 small onion, chopped
1/4 cup dry bread crumbs
2 tablespoons milk
3/4 teaspoon salt, divided
1/4 teaspoon pepper
1/2 pound ground beef
1/3 cup water
2 tablespoons brown sugar
2 tablespoons ketchup
1/2 teaspoon ground mustard
1/2 teaspoon white vinegar
2 hamburger buns, optional
Sliced red onion, optional

Steps:

  • In a small bowl, combine the onion, bread crumbs, milk, 1/2 teaspoon salt and pepper. Crumble beef over mixture and mix well. Shape into two patties. Place in a greased 11x7-in. baking dish. , Combine the water, brown sugar, ketchup, mustard, vinegar and remaining salt; pour over patties. , Bake, uncovered, at 350° until a thermometer reads 160°, about 35-40 minutes. If desired, serve on buns with red onion.

HAMBURGER SAFETY TIPS - CANADA.CA
Cook hamburger and other ground meats thoroughly. Ground beef can turn brown before disease-causing bacteria are killed. Remove the hamburger from the grill, pan or oven and use a digital thermometer to take the temperature in the thickest part of the meat. Cook until the thermometer reads at least 71ºC (160ºF).
